A very common source of confusion is the "NAT Loopback" issue. If you try to access your public IP address (e.g., http://your.public.ip:8080 ) from a computer on your local network, many routers will block this connection. They see it as a security risk or get confused. If the software refuses to save new settings, you may have to resort to a workaround. Some users have reported that changes made through WebcamXP are not saved on restart. In this case, the most reliable solution is to delete the problematic camera source completely , add it again as if it were new, and then reconfigure your parameters. While cumbersome, this is often the only way to force the software to commit changes to its service layer.
